Symantic Ghost, but yeah...
You shouldn't constantly Ghost... Ghosting is for making a base drive, say you install everything you have (NOT games) and then ghost the drive (Don't install SP2 either) if your desktop dies you have a way to restore everything to working condition.

But you should just get a file mover, and get a flash drive.
